In response to Pope John Paul II’s call for “a clearly
conceived, serious and well-organized effort to evangelize culture,” the Our Lady of Walsingham
Institutes of Catholic Culture Studies is constantly developing and implementing innovative educational and cultural programs. These programs are modern vehicles to rediscover
and educate lay persons regarding the rich cultural and historical traditions,
as well as the intellectual and spiritual heritage, of the Roman Catholic
Church. Specifically, we seek to kindle
a spiritual and intellectual renewal of
American culture.
